Portland’s Enhanced Service Districts expand upon basic City services to add vibrancy, maintain cleanliness, improve safety, assist with business development, engage in marketing, and improve transportation. The districts are funded, in part, by the Property Management License fee.  Each district is independently administered.

Clean and Safe District

213 blocks in Portland's downtown core area

clean

License Year

October 1 through September 30

Billing Information

  • Bills are mailed on or around August 1, and the first of two installment payments is due on October 1.
  • 2nd installment bills are mailed on February 1, and the payment is due on April 1.

Any unpaid amounts will be assessed penalties and interest until paid. Payments must be paid online or postmarked no later than the due date.

Lloyd District

Oregon Convention Center area and nearby NE Portland

License Year

February 1 through January 31

Billing Information

  • Bills are mailed on or around January 1, and the first of two installment payments is due on February 15.
  • 2nd installment bills are mailed on August 1, and the payment is due on September 15.

Any unpaid amounts will be assessed penalties and interest until paid. Payments must be paid online or postmarked no later than the due date.

Central Eastside Industrial District

681-acre district encompassing property south of I-84 to Powell and from the Willamette River to SE 12th

License Year

July 1 through June 30

Billing Information

  • Bills are mailed on or around May 1, and the first of two installment payments is due on July 1.
  • 2nd installment bills are mailed on December 1, and the payment is due on February 1.

Any unpaid amounts will be assessed penalties and interest until paid. Payments must be paid online or postmarked no later than the due date.

Additional Information

The Enhanced Service District fee is paid by entities who meet the following criteria for properties within a district’s boundaries, in order of importance:

  1. Financially responsible for the water service to a property,
  2. Exclusively occupy a property, or
  3. Exhibit other indicators of property management

Examples include property owners, tenants, property management services, and developers.

The entity responsible for the fee at the beginning of a license year is responsible for the entire year's assessment unless the Revenue Division approves a transfer before the second installment becomes due. Transfer requests should be reported to the Revenue Division in writing and may be approved upon the Division’s confirmation that a new entity meets the criteria listed above.  Second installment balances become the responsibility of the new entity for transfers prior to the due date.

Assessment Appeals

Responsibility for the fee or the amount assessed may be appealed within 30 days of the date of the annual fee notice. 

  • To appeal responsibility for the fee, the appellant must clearly demonstrate why they believe they are not responsible as defined by Portland City Code 6.06.020.H.4 or 6.06.050
  • To appeal the amount of the fee, the appellant must clearly demonstrate the data or formula used to calculate the fee is incorrect in accordance with the appropriate sections of Portland City Code 6.06 for the district in which the property is located. 

The appeals deadlines for the districts are:

  • Clean and Safe District: on or around August 30
  • Lloyd District: on or around January 30
  • Central Eastside Industrial District: on or around May 30
